>>  That amount that the data will grow is almost completely based on your
>> SIS. I’ve seen between 20% and 50%. I won’t say that 200% or 300% is
>> impossible – but I’d say it’s atypical.****
>>
>> ** **
>>
>> The only clients I have that are using SAN already have a large SAN
>> investment. New deployments have been DAS, almost exclusively.****

>> We currently have 400GB worth of data on our Exchange 2007 setup.  From
>> what I’ve read, we can expect that to double or triple when we move to
>> Exchange 2010 and lose single instance storage.  ** **
>>
>> What type of disk configuration are you using for 2010?  Local disks or a
>> SAN?
